The Importance of Regulation
Regulation is essential for ensuring the fairness and integrity of online gambling. It helps to prevent fraudulent behavior and ensures that operators are following the rules and providing a safe and secure environment for their customers. Without proper regulation, consumers are at risk of being taken advantage of and falling victim to unscrupulous operators.
Regulation also provides a framework for resolving disputes and ensures that players have recourse in the event of any issues or concerns. This level of oversight is crucial for maintaining the trust and confidence of consumers in the online gambling industry.
The Future of Regulation
As online gambling continues to evolve and expand, the need for effective regulation becomes increasingly evident. In many jurisdictions, efforts are being made to update and modernize existing regulations to better address the challenges of online gambling. This includes implementing stricter licensing requirements, improving responsible gambling measures, and enhancing consumer protection provisions.
While the future of online gambling regulation is still uncertain, it is clear that there is a collective effort to create a more robust and comprehensive regulatory environment that prioritizes consumer protection and the integrity of the industry.
Empowering Consumers
Consumer protection is a fundamental aspect of online gambling regulation. It is imperative to empower consumers with the information and resources they need to make informed decisions and protect themselves from potential harm. This includes promoting responsible gambling practices, providing access to support services for individuals struggling with gambling addiction, and ensuring that consumers are aware of their rights and protections under the law.
By prioritizing consumer protection, regulators and operators can work together to create a safer and more sustainable online gambling environment that benefits both the industry and its patrons.
